Fun Public Pools for Families Near West Palm Beach, Florida

1. Lake Lytal Family Aquatic Center—West Palm Beach

This pool is open all year round and water is kept between 78 and 82 degrees. This center offers times each day for lap-lane swimming, to use diving boards/slides, play in the children’s pool, and open swim. Throughout the year, it offers classes and programs in junior lifeguard camp​, American Red Cross lifeguard certification​​​, American Red Cross water safety instructor certification,​ and American Red Cross CPR certification.

2. Pioneer Park Aquatic Center at Glades Pioneer Park​—Belle Glade

This pool and aquatic center offers a tipping bucket water feature, waterslides, and a year-round water temperature of between 78 and 82 degrees. This pool also offers a learn-to-swim program. Though open all year round, patrons should visit its website as hours vary seasonally.

3. The Swim & Racquet Center—Boca Raton

This facility is open year round and offers a 25-yard long, six-lane pool that is heated during the winter months and cooled during the summer. The average water temperature is between 80 and 83 degrees. Amenities include a heated kiddie pool, splash pad and playground, an aquatic chair lift that meets ADA regulations, locker rooms and showers, and kickboards, noodles, and life vests.

4. Warren Hawkins Aquatic Center—West Palm Beach

Located in Gaines Park and open from May to November, this pool features eight 25-meter lanes with two deep waterslides, a wading pool, and a splash pad that is accessible from the pool deck and park. The pool is fully accessible,  provides shaded areas for families, and offers programming for all ages and abilities. It offers programs such as learn-to-swim, water fitness, water safety instructor, and American Red Cross classes.
